Mazda MX-5 Superlight leaks
Sat, 12 Sep 2009Official pictures of the MX-5 Superlight Concept have leaked out ahead of Frankfurt We don’t think Mazda are intending building the MX-5 Superlight, it’s more a way of showcasing what can be achieved by radical weight saving. But don’t quote us on that. If Mazda gets big positive feedback they’ll probably turn it in to a production model despite their assertions it’s just a concept.
BMW Roadster Concept: BMW Vision ConnectedDrive Geneva debut
Thu, 10 Feb 2011BMW Vision ConnectedDrive We reported the other day that BMW were taking a roadster concept to the Geneva Motor Show, a car we expected to point the way to a new, smaller roadster – the BMW Z2. But it seems to be much more than just that. The BMW Vision ConnectedDrive – for that is the catchy little moniker BMW has attached to this concept – is a showcase for BMW technology and the layered styling language we’ve already seen in the Vision EfficientDynamics concept (can’t we have some snappy little monikers instead of Anglicising the German practice of just joining words together in a line to make a new word?).
